Output 93ca694154fbd1b38465b62bf3a41e96fd16a5007e198f7ba245bd8a77e48ae5:3

value
2374993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6a650b1f9c7baaad4dd64f2f37cdbccddbc668 OP_EQUAL
address
3HE6Fb5THeh8pTWgyRYyaTa7ssMwjvppWu
transaction
93ca694154fbd1b38465b62bf3a41e96fd16a5007e198f7ba245bd8a77e48ae5
confirmations
311354
spent
false

12 Sat Ranges